KUCHING: Known for its many signature products such as Ikan Terubuk, Kek Lapis Sarawak, Buah Engkalak and pepper, among others, Sarawak has already reached out to international connectivity for their value-added merchandises.

Despite evolving, the locals are still keeping their traditional activities by producing freshly picked harvests directly from the jungle.

A stopover to Kubah Ria, Satok in Kuching, people would encounter many natural products and these are potentially great items to lure anyone due to its uniqueness - tourists or locals alike to visit the place where the wet market is located.
